Outside of that, been working a bit more lately and watching random shite. Having run out of episodes of Forged in Fire, I came across the Great British Baking Show and absolutely fell in love with everything about it. Got me back in the kitchen experimenting with new food/recipes again. Been too long there. Some decent movies I came across have been:
Straight Up - Dialogue driven film tackling topics like asexuality and acceptance while blending in comedy. Great film if you enjoy dialogue focused works. Whole thing was shot in less than 2 weeks I believe. The interviews with the cast and director were a good watch as well.
Funan - Animated film tackling the effects of the Khmer Rouge on a family forced from their home. Don't expect a happy, uplifting film here.
Hustle - Adam Sandler giving another shot at serious acting instead of donning a silly voice in some "comedy". In short, he nails it. Fantastic sports movie, worth a watch even if you aren't interest in basketball (which I very much am not). Expect an uplifting film of perseverance and hard work here :}
